WordPress Kategorie Beschreibung

Ich ordne ja meine Beiträge hier im Blog einzelnen Kategorien zu. Dies hat den Vorteil, das ein interessierter Leser sofort zu seiner bevorzugten Kategorie springen kann, um dann die entsprechenden Beiträge ansehen zu können.

Mich störte aber bislang die Tatsache, das mancher Kategoriename für den unwissenden Leser beim ersten Lesen keinen Sinn ergab, so z.B. bei der Kategorie PSR-S900, welche Beiträge rund um das Yamaha Keyboard PSR-S900 enthält. Es war allerdings auch nicht in meinem Interesse, die Kategorienamen unendlich lang zu machen, was der Übersicht sicherlich Schaden würde. Eine andere Lösung musste daher gefunden werden!

Nachdem ich mir in WordPress den Menüpunkt für Kategorien genauer ansah, fiel mir auf, das es hier einen Punkt Beschreibung gab. Dieses Feld wäre natürlich ideal, hier könnte ich zum einzelnen Kategorienamen noch einen kleinen Text dazuschreiben, so dass ein Leser sofort wissen würde, was in dieser Kategorie behandelt wird.

Also gleich einen entsprechenden Text in das Beschreibungsfeld eingefügt und mich gefreut. Wobei die Freude nur von kurzer Dauer sein sollte, denn im Blog war bis auf den title-Tag des Kategorie-Links nichts passiert.

Also geschwind auf die WordPress Codex Seite gesurft, um dann herauszufinden wie man die Kategoriebeschreibung auch auf der Kategorieseite anzeigt. Der Befehl ist recht einfach und lautet:

<?php echo category_description( $category ); ?> 

Dieser Codeschnipsel musste dann nur noch in der category.php des Themes eingebunden werden. Ich entschied mich dazu, das ganze in eine h3-Überschrift zu verpflanzen. Nun erscheint also unter der eigentlichen Kategorie Hauptüberschrift noch eine Unterüberschrift, welche den Kategorie Beschreibungstext anzeigt. Das ganze sieht dann im Code so aus:

<h2><?php single_cat_title(); ?></h2>
<h3><?php echo category_description( $category ); ?></h3> 

Dem h3-Tag noch eine Klasse zugewiesen und über die style.css dem Layout angepasst! Wie das Ergebnis nun ausschaut, könnt ihr ganz einfach feststellen, in dem ihr einfach ganz oben auf eine Kategorie klickt.

Ich bin zufrieden, genau so habe ich mir das vorgestellt. Wenn nun ein neuer Besucher durch die Kategorien klickt, bekommt er auch sofort einen kleinen Text angezeigt, der ihm vermittelt was ihn in dieser Kategorie erwartet. Bellissimo!

  1. martin sagt:

    super, genau wonach ich für meine seite http://tierfrage.net gesucht habe.
    hast du zufällig ne idee, wie der kategorie beschreibungstext nur auf der ersten seite erscheint und nicht auf allen blätter_/unterseiten?

    dank
    martin

    05.11.2010 um 11:38 Uhr

  2. Uwe sagt:

    Danke Dir, das habe ich auch gerade gesucht. Komischerweise wird in den meisten Templates die Kategorie Beschreibung nicht berücksichtigt. Jetzt hab ich hier http://www.wo-ist-die.de/kateg.....-freizeit/ auch ne Beschreibung und google freut sich über mehr Text. =)

    02.05.2011 um 12:59 Uhr

Kommentar verfassen

Deine Emailadresse wird niemals veröffentlicht oder weitergegeben.

Dein Kommentar:

=) ;) :| :twisted: :o :mrgreen: :lol: :kiss: :holy: :heart: :cry: :P :D :/ :) :( 8O 8)